|  
  以Oracle用戶登陸。 
1.解壓9206補丁安裝包 
$unzip p3948480_9206_solaris64.zip 
2.設置環境變量Oracle_HOME和ORACLE_SID 
$ Oracle_HOME=/opt/oracle/db01/app/oracle/product/9.2.0 
$ Oracle_SID=ORCL 
$ export Oracle_HOME ORACLE_SID- 
  
 
3.停止DB和所有Oracle相關進程 
SQL> shutdown immediate 
$lsnrctl stop 
4.備份Oracle安裝目錄 
$tar -cvf Oracle9204_clear.tar db01 db02 db03 db04 
5.如果是使用XManager之類軟件遠程登陸安裝,則需要設置DISPLAY: 
$ DISPLAY=172.19.136.98:0.0; export DISPLAY --172.19.136.98是運行XManager軟件的PC客戶端IP 
6.進入XWindow,啟動安裝程序 
% cd /opt/wacos/9206/Disk1 
% ./runInstaller 
按照屏幕提示操作安裝下去。 
7.設置初始化參數SHARED_POOL_SIZE和JAVA_POOL_SIZE 
$sqlplus '/as sysdba' 
SQL> startup; 
SQL> show parameter pfile; 
SQL> show parameter shared_pool_size; 
SQL> ALTER SYSTEM SET SHARED_POOL_SIZE='150M' SCOPE=spfile; --at least 150 MB 
SQL> show parameter java_pool_size; 
SQL> ALTER SYSTEM SET JAVA_POOL_SIZE='150M' SCOPE=spfile; --at least 150 MB 
SQL> shutdown; 
SQL> exit 
8.升級DB(Non-RAC) 
$ lsnrctl start 
$ sqlplus /nolog 
SQL> conn /as sysdba 
SQL> startup migrate 
SQL> spool ./patch9206.log 
SQL> @?/rdbms/admin/catpatch.sql --時間較長 
SQL> spool off; 
9.檢查patch.log看是否有錯.  
$more patch9206.log 
10.編譯所有失效對象 
SQL> shutdown; 
SQL> startup; 
SQL> @?/rdbms/admin/utlrp.sql 
11.核查升級信息.  
SQL> select * from dba_registry; 
12.打包備份 
$lsnrctl stop 
$sqlplus '/as sysdba' 
SQL> shutdown immediate; 
$tar -cvf Oracle9206_clear.tar db01 db02 db03 db04 
   本文出自:億恩科技【www.endtimedelusion.com】 
      
      
		服務器租用/服務器托管中國五強!虛擬主機域名注冊頂級提供商!15年品質保障!--億恩科技[ENKJ.COM] 
       |